Cactus Jack Shorts: A Statement Piece in Modern Streetwear Fashion

In the ever-evolving world of fashion, few names carry the weight and cultural influence of Cactus Jack—the label founded by music and fashion icon Travis Scott. Known for its bold aesthetic and deep roots in hip-hop and street cultur, Cactus Jack  isn't just a brand—it's a lifestyle. Among its most coveted pieces, Cactus Jack shorts have quickly emerged as a must-have for those who want to merge comfort, style, and individuality.
